Desideri installare un’app interessante o un quadrante che non sia ufficialmente disponibile per il tuo smartwatch Wear OS? Puoi, e c’è più di un modo per farlo. Utilizzando un’app di terze parti sul tuo smartphone o lanciando alcuni comandi dal Terminale sul tuo PC, la scelta è tua.
Come eseguire il sideload di un’app su Wear OS utilizzando il telefono
Questo è il metodo più semplice per caricare localmente le app su uno smartwatch Wear OS. Utilizzeremo un’app di terze parti chiamata Bugjaeger per accoppiare e connettere l’orologio e quindi installare un APK.
Per prima cosa, dovrai abilitare le Opzioni sviluppatore. Sul tuo smartwatch Wear OS, scorri verso l’alto dal basso o da destra per visualizzare il cassetto delle app. Successivamente, apri l’app Impostazioni e vai su Informazioni sull’orologio > Software > Versione software.
Tocca “Versione software” sette volte o finché non viene visualizzato il popup “Modalità sviluppatore attivata” sullo schermo.
Ora scorri indietro per tornare alla pagina delle impostazioni principali e vai su “Opzioni sviluppatore”: dovrebbe trovarsi in fondo all’elenco o appena sotto “Informazioni su Watch”. Da lì, attiva “Debug ADB”.
Scorri verso il basso, tocca il menu Debug wireless e attiva l’opzione “Debug wireless”. Assicurati che l’orologio sia connesso a una rete Wi-Fi.
Associazione dell’orologio
Adesso prendi il tuo telefono Android e installare il Applicazione Bugjaeger dal Google Play Store. Apri l’app e fai clic sull’icona della nuova connessione. Nel menu a comparsa, tocca il pulsante “Abbina”. Nella schermata successiva ti verrà chiesto di fornire l’indirizzo IP, la porta e il codice di accoppiamento dell’orologio.
Sul tuo orologio, vai su Impostazioni > Opzioni sviluppatore > Debug wireless. Scorri fino in fondo e tocca il sottomenu “Abbina nuovo dispositivo”.
Attendi qualche secondo e sullo schermo verranno visualizzati il codice di accoppiamento Wi-Fi, l’indirizzo IP e la porta.
Inserisci i valori visualizzati nell’app Bugjaeger nei rispettivi campi e fai clic su “Abbina”. Verrà avviato il processo di accoppiamento e, presupponendo che tu abbia seguito correttamente i passaggi, dovresti essere accolto con il messaggio “Accoppiamento riuscito a 192.xxx.xx:xxxx” sullo schermo. Non chiudere il menu popup.
È importante non lasciare che lo schermo dell’orologio entri in modalità di sospensione o che lasci il menu “Accoppia nuovo dispositivo” mentre inserisci il codice e la porta di accoppiamento Wi-Fi. In questo modo l’orologio genererà un nuovo codice di accoppiamento e una porta, rendendo quelli precedenti inutilizzabili.
Collegamento dell’orologio
Ora che l’orologio è accoppiato con successo al tuo smartphone, è il momento di connetterlo effettivamente per poter installare l’APK.
Sul tuo smartwatch, torna al menu Debug wireless.
Trova l’indirizzo IP e la porta e inserisci questi valori nei rispettivi campi nell’app Bugjaeger: l’app compila automaticamente l’indirizzo IP, quindi dovrai solo inserire la porta. Fare clic su “Connetti” e attendere finché non viene stabilita la connessione.
Assicurati di connetterti alla porta che appare nel menu Debug wireless e non a quella che appare nel sottomenu “Accoppia nuovo dispositivo”.
Se l’orologio non riesce a connettersi, verificare le seguenti condizioni:
- L’orologio e lo smartphone sono collegati alla stessa rete Wi-Fi.
- Hai completato il processo di accoppiamento in anticipo.
- Ti stai connettendo alla porta che appare nel menu Debug wireless e non a quella che appare nel sottomenu “Accoppia nuovo dispositivo”.
Installazione dell’app
Ora che il tuo smartwatch è collegato al telefono, è il momento di caricare l’app. In questo esempio, utilizziamo l’APK di Google Pixel Watch Faces, ma puoi seguire gli stessi passaggi per installare praticamente qualsiasi app compatibile con Wear OS. Assicurati solo di ottenere le tue app da fonti attendibili, come APK Mirror o forum per sviluppatori XDA.
Per prima cosa, scarica l’APK di Pixel Watch Faces e salvalo nella memoria del tuo telefono. Quindi apri l’app Bugjaeger e scegli “Pacchetti”. Successivamente, fai clic sull’icona più situata nell’angolo in basso a sinistra e scegli Seleziona file APK.
Questo aprirà il selettore file Android. Scorri da destra per visualizzare il menu laterale e scegli la cartella Download.
Individua l’APK di Pixel Watch Faces e toccalo per avviare l’installazione. Il processo di installazione potrebbe richiedere del tempo a seconda delle dimensioni dell’APK e dell’hardware del tuo smartwatch. Una volta installata l’app, disattiva il debug ADB e il debug wireless sull’orologio accedendo a Opzioni sviluppatore.
Come eseguire il sideload di un’app su Wear OS utilizzando un PC
Questo è un metodo più complesso per caricamento laterale app su uno smartwatch Wear OS. Implica il collegamento dell’orologio al PC e l’attivazione di alcuni comandi ADB nel prompt dei comandi o nel terminale. Se il primo metodo non ha funzionato per te e non ti dispiace sporcarti le mani, questa è la strada da percorrere.
Prima di procedere, assicurati di aver abilitato in anticipo le “Opzioni sviluppatore”: in caso contrario, fai riferimento al primo metodo per istruzioni. Dovrai inoltre installare gli strumenti della piattaforma Android SDK sul tuo PC, che include Utilità Android Debug Bridge (ADB)..
Apri il browser web del tuo PC e scarica l’app che desideri installare sul tuo smartwatch. Ancora una volta, in questo esempio utilizziamo l’app Google Pixel Watchfaces. Vai alla cartella in cui hai scaricato il file APK e apri la finestra del prompt dei comandi, di PowerShell o del Terminale in questa directory. Già che ci sei, rinomina anche il file APK in qualcosa di breve e semplice (credimi, ti renderà la vita molto più semplice quando esegui i comandi ADB).
Prendi il tuo smartwatch, vai su Impostazioni > Opzioni sviluppatore e attiva il debug ADB. Successivamente, scorri verso il basso, tocca Debug wireless e seleziona Associa nuovo dispositivo. Lo schermo visualizzerà l’indirizzo IP, la porta e il codice di accoppiamento Wi-Fi dell’orologio. Mantieni questa schermata aperta e torna alla finestra Terminale sul tuo PC.
Nel Terminale, inserisci il seguente comando:
adb pair 192.168.XX.XXX:XXXXX Sostituisci il testo segnaposto con l’indirizzo IP e il numero di porta effettivi visualizzati sull’orologio. Quindi, se l’indirizzo IP del tuo orologio è 192.168.60.180 e la porta è 41619, il comando adb sarà simile a questo: adb coppia 192.168.60.180:41619. Successivamente, ti verrà richiesto di fornire un codice di accoppiamento. Inserisci il codice di accoppiamento Wi-Fi a sei cifre visualizzato sull’orologio e premi Invio. Dovresti vedere un messaggio di conferma nella finestra del prompt dei comandi che indica che l’orologio è stato accoppiato con successo all’indirizzo IP specificato.
Il prossimo passo è eseguire il comando “adb connect” in modo da poter stabilire una connessione con lo smartwatch e inviare l’APK. Scorri indietro sul tuo smartwatch per tornare al menu Debug wireless. Prendere nota dell’indirizzo IP e della porta elencati sotto la propria intestazione.
Quindi torna alla finestra del prompt dei comandi e inserisci il comando seguente. Ancora una volta, assicurati di sostituire il testo segnaposto (X) con l’indirizzo IP e la porta visualizzati sull’orologio.
adb connect 192.168.XX.XXX:XXXXX Finalmente è il momento di installare la nostra app. Inserisci il seguente comando nel prompt dei comandi, assicurandoti di sostituire il testo segnaposto con l’indirizzo IP dell’orologio, la porta e il nome esatto dell’app.
adb -s 192.168.XX.XXX:XXXX install XXX.apk Il processo di installazione potrebbe richiedere del tempo, quindi sii paziente. Se tutto va bene, dovresti vedere il messaggio “Successo” nel Terminale. Questo è tutto. L’app è stata installata con successo sul tuo smartwatch e puoi verificarla aprendo il cassetto delle app e scorrendo fino in fondo. Infine, esegui il comando seguente nel Terminale per disconnettere il debug ADB:
adb disconnect Il sideload delle app su uno smartwatch non è così semplice come farlo su un telefono Android, ma probabilmente non ti ritroverai a doverlo fare così tanto. Per fortuna, è possibile farlo con i metodi sopra descritti.